Not surprisingly given that below normal precipitation prevailed most of the year in most places, drought of varying intensity was a big story during 2023.Ten days of rain on the Front Range and Eastern Plains of Colorado reduced drought conditions in the state by more than 60%, continuing a statewide recovery from drought over the past year. The amount of the state experiencing drought conditions has dropped from 93% a year ago to just 11% today. May is normally the wettest month …See all nearby weather stations. CoCoRaHS (pronounced KO-ko-rozz) is a grassroots volunteer network of backyard weather observers of all ages and backgrounds working together to measure and map precipitation (rain, hail and snow) in their local communities. May 12, 2023 · Rainfall totals from across the region over the last two days are impressive to say the least. Denver International Airport was reporting 3.57" of precipitation as of midnight last night between Wednesday and Thursday's rain. So far today the station is reporting 0.47" of rain, which takes our three day total to more than 4.0" of rain! Colorado saw several rain and hail storms May 10-12. Denver received 2.92" on Thursday ...Jul 1, 2023 · Here's a look at Colorado rainfall totals during the June 29 through June 30 storms from the Community Collaborative Rain, Hail, & Snow Network (CoCoRaHS), which is a network of weather watchers and volunteers. 0.6 E Holyoke – 3.10 inches. 11.6 SSE Haxtun – 2.96 inches. 5.6 W Denver – 2.02 inches. 2.3 ESE Wheat Ridge – 1.97 inches. Still, Colorado is in a much better position overall, he said. At the end of December, drought conditions were logged in about 86% of the state. The week of Jan. 3, most of the eastern plains still was dry, with severe or extreme conditions recorded along the state border. Precipitation from May 1 – June 30, 2023 yielded widespread totals in excess of 10 inches for many areas of the Front Range and Eastern Plains of Colorado. The January precipitation total for the contiguous U.S. was 2.85 inches, 0.54 inch above average, ranking in the wettest third of the 129-year record.
